Владельцы смартфонов Samsung нередко сталкиваются с необъяснимым нагревом корпуса или резким падением заряда батареи. При детальном анализе запущенных процессов в меню разработчика или через сторонние мониторы ресурсов часто всплывает системная задача с названием SilentLog или SilentLogManagerService. Пользователи сразу же начинают искать информацию о том, является ли этот файл вирусом или критически важным компонентом операционной системы Android.

На самом деле, это штатный инструмент логирования, встроенный производителями для отладки работы устройства. Silent Log предназначен для сбора технической информации о работе различных модулей телефона в фоновом режиме. Данные записываются в скрытые файлы журналов, которые могут быть полезны инженерам сервисных центров при диагностике сложных сбоев, не воспроизводимых в реальном времени.

Однако в обычных пользовательских сценариях эта функция часто становится причиной проблем с производительностью. Если вы заметили, что Samsung тормозит или быстро разряжается, а в списке активных процессов доминирует SilentLog, то пришло время разобраться в причинах такого поведения и методах решения проблемы. В этой статье мы подробно рассмотрим назначение службы и способы её безопасной деактивации.

Назначение и функционал SilentLogManagerService

Системный процесс SilentLog является частью оболочки One UI от компании Samsung. Его основная задача — непрерывный мониторинг состояния системы и запись событий в лог-файлы. В отличие от обычных логов, которые могут быть доступны пользователю, эти данные собираются «тихо» (отсюда и название Silent), не требуя подтверждения действий со стороны владельца смартфона.

Инженеры используют эти данные для анализа причин внезапных перезагрузок, ошибок в работе радиомодуля или сбоев в работе сенсорного экрана. Критически важно понимать, что SilentLog не является вирусом или вредоносным ПО, даже если антивирусные программы иногда реагируют на его активность как на подозрительную. Это легитимный компонент прошивки, который, однако, может работать некорректно.

В нормальном состоянии службы логирования потребляют минимальное количество ресурсов процессора. Проблемы начинаются тогда, когда цикл записи логов попадает в бесконечный цикл или конфликтует с другим системным процессом. В такой ситуации SilentLog начинает агрессивно использовать ЦП, вызывая нагрев и быстро сажая батарею.

Стоит отметить, что на разных моделях Samsung (например, Galaxy S21, A52, Note 20) поведение этой службы может отличаться в зависимости от версии Android и установленной оболочки. Иногда проблема кроется в конкретном обновлении безопасности, которое содержит ошибки в коде менеджера логирования.

💡

Перед тем как вмешиваться в работу системных процессов, сделайте резервную копию важных данных. Хотя отключение логов безопасно, любые изменения в системе несут минимальный риск нестаб

Почему Silent Log грузит процессор и батарею

Основная причина высокой нагрузки кроется в программном сбое. Когда SilentLog пытается записать данные в файл журнала, но файл заблокирован другим процессом или переполнен, служба не завершает операцию, а продолжает попытки снова и снова. Это создает эффект «штормового» логирования, когда за доли секунды выполняются тысячи операций записи.

Другой распространенной причиной является конфликт после обновления прошивки. Если вы недавно обновили свой Samsung до новой версии Android или получили патч безопасности, старые конфигурационные файлы могут некорректно взаимодействовать с новым кодом службы логирования. В результате процесс SilentLogManagerService зависает в активном состоянии.

Также стоит учитывать влияние сторонних приложений. Некоторые программы, особенно те, которые требуют глубокого доступа к системе (клинеры, оптимизаторы, модификаторы интерфейса), могут блокировать доступ к системным ресурсам, которые пытается использовать Silent Log. Это приводит к постоянным попыткам службы получить необходимый доступ.

Может ли это быть вирус?

Хотя сам процесс SilentLog является системным, вирусы часто маскируются под системные службы. Если вы видите похожее название, но с опечаткой (например, SilentLogg или SiIentLog), это почти наверняка вредонос. Настоящий SilentLog находится в системном разделе и не может быть удален стандартными методами без root-прав.

Для визуализации причин проблем рассмотрим таблицу симптомов:

Симптом Вероятная причина Степень опасности
Нагрев в верхней части корпуса Перегрев процессора из-за циклической записи логов Средняя (износ батареи)
Быстрый разряд в режиме ожидания Процесс не уходит в сон (wakelock) Высокая (неудобство)
Лаги интерфейса и меню Нехватка ресурсов ЦП для отрисовки UI Средняя
Ошибки в работе Wi-Fi/Bluetooth Конфликт драйверов и службы логирования Низкая

Если вы наблюдаете один или несколько из перечисленных симптомов, и в диспетчере задач «тяжелым» процессом является именно SilentLog, необходимо предпринять действия по его остановке. Игнорирование проблемы может привести к ускоренной деградации аккумуляторной батареи.

📊 Сталкивались ли вы с перегревом Samsung?
Да, телефон раскаляется
Бывает, но редко
Нет, все работает отлично
У меня другой бренд

Методы отключения Silent Log через настройки

Самый безопасный и простой способ остановить навязчивый процесс — использовать встроенные возможности диагностики Samsung. Производитель предусмотрел скрытое меню, позволяющее управлять режимами логирования без необходимости получения прав суперпользователя (Root).

Для начала необходимо активировать меню разработчика, если оно скрыто. Перейдите в Настройки → О телефоне → Информация о ПО. Найдите пункт «Номер сборки» и быстро нажмите на него 7 раз подряд. Система сообщит, что режим разработчика активирован. После этого вернитесь в главное меню настроек, где внизу появится новый пункт Параметры разработчика.

Внутри меню разработчика найдите раздел, связанный с отладкой или системными логами. На разных версиях One UI путь может отличаться, но часто помогает сброс настроек отладки. Однако более эффективным методом является использование специального кода в «звонилке».

Откройте приложение «Телефон» и наберите комбинацию *#9900#. Это откроет скрытое меню SysDump. В открывшемся списке найдите пункт Silent Log или Log Level. Если вы видите вариант Low или Off, выберите его. Это принудительно ограничит объем собираемой информации.

☑️ Проверка перед отключением

Выполнено: 0 / 4

После изменения параметров обязательно перезагрузите устройство. Обычного выключения экрана недостаточно, необходимо выполнить полный цикл Power Off и включения. Это позволит системе перечитать конфигурационные файлы и запустить службы с новыми параметрами.

Использование ADB для продвинутого управления

Если стандартные методы не помогают, можно воспользоваться инструментом ADB (Android Debug Bridge). Этот способ требует наличия компьютера (Windows, macOS или Linux) и кабеля USB. Он позволяет отправлять команды непосредственно в операционную систему, минуя пользовательский интерфейс.

Сначала необходимо включить отладку по USB в меню разработчика на телефоне. Подключите смартфон к ПК и убедитесь, что на экране устройства появилось разрешение на отладку — его нужно подтвердить. На компьютере откройте командную строку в папке с инструментами ADB.

Для остановки службы SilentLog введите следующую команду:

adb shell am stopservice com.samsung.android.silentlogmanager

Эта команда принудительно остановит процесс. Однако после перезагрузки он может запуститься снова. Чтобы полностью Disable (отключить) пакет, предотвратив его автозапуск, используйте команду:

adb shell pm disable-user --user 0 com.samsung.android.silentlogmanager

⚠️ Внимание: Будьте предельно осторожны при использовании команды pm disable-user. Отключение критически важных системных пакетов может привести к нестабильной работе телефона или циклической перезагрузке (bootloop). Убедитесь, что пакетное имя указано верно.

Если после применения команды телефон начал вести себя некорректно, вы всегда можете вернуть всё обратно. Для этого используется команда pm enable с тем же именем пакета. Это преимущество метода ADB перед удалением файлов через Root-права — изменения обратимы.

Важно понимать, что ADB дает мощные инструменты, но требует внимательности. Не отключайте пакеты, назначение которых вам неизвестно. SilentLog относительно безопасен для отключения, так как это лишь инструмент диагностики, но другие системные службы трогать не стоит.

Сброс настроек и очистка кэша

Часто проблема кроется не в самой службе, а в накопленном мусоре или поврежденных временных файлах. Перед радикальными мерами попробуйте очистить кэш раздела восстановления (Wipe Cache Partition). Это не удалит ваши личные данные (фото, контакты), но очистит системный кэш.

Для входа в режим Recovery на Samsung обычно нужно выключить телефон, затем зажать комбинацию кнопок (часто это Громкость Вверх + Кнопка питания, иногда требуется подключение кабеля к ПК). В меню навигация осуществляется кнопками громкости, а выбор — кнопкой питания.

Выберите пункт Wipe Cache Partition и подтвердите действие. После завершения выберите Reboot system now. Эта процедура часто решает проблемы с зависшими системными процессами, включая SilentLog, особенно после крупных обновлений Android.

Если и это не помогло, крайним программным методом является сброс до заводских настроек. Перед этим обязательно сохраните все данные. Сброс вернет телефон к состоянию «из коробки», удалив все конфликты программного обеспечения, которые могли вызвать сбой логирования.

💡

Очистка кэш-раздела (Wipe Cache Partition) решает 80% проблем с системными процессами после обновления прошивки, не затрагивая личные файлы пользователя.

Стоит ли удалять SilentLog навсегда

Многие пользователи задаются вопросом: нужно ли удалять этот процесс навсегда, особенно если телефон используется как основной и критически важен для работы? Удаление возможно только при наличии Root-прав и системного модификатора, например, System App Remover или через магиск-модули.

С одной стороны, удаление освободит место и гарантированно остановит процесс. С другой стороны, лишение системы инструмента отладки может затруднить диагностику в будущем, если возникнут более серьезные аппаратные или программные сбои. Кроме того, некоторые системные приложения могут ожидать ответа от менеджера логов.

Опытные пользователи рекомендуют не удалять файл физически, а именно «замораживать» его с помощью инструментов вроде Titanium Backup или SD Maid (при наличии Root). Заморозка делает процесс неактивным, но оставляет его в системе на случай необходимости восстановления.

Для большинства обычных пользователей оптимальным решением является именно отключение через ADB или настройку в меню *#9900#. Этого достаточно, чтобы остановить нагрев и разряд, сохраняя целостность системных файлов.

⚠️ Внимание: Если вы решите удалять системные файлы вручную через файловый менеджер с Root-доступом, всегда делайте полную резервную копию (Nandroid backup) перед началом операции. Ошибка в одном байте может сделать телефон «кирпичом».

В заключение, Silent Log на Samsung — это полезный, но иногда проблемный инструмент. Его активность не должна пугать, если она не влияет на автономность. Но если телефон превращается в «грелку», грамотное отключение службы вернет комфорт использования.

Влияние на гарантию

Использование ADB команд для отключения системных процессов, как правило, не является основанием для отказа в гарантийном обслуживании, так как это программное изменение, сбрасываемое полным сбросом. Однако получение Root-прав гарантию аннулирует.

Часто задаваемые вопросы (FAQ)

Безопасно ли полностью отключать SilentLog на Samsung?

Да, это безопасно. Это служебный процесс для сбора логов, и для повседневного использования смартфона (звонки, интернет, фото) он не требуется. Его отключение не повлияет на стабильность работы основных функций.

Почему процесс SilentLog появился только после обновления?

Обновление прошивки часто меняет структуру системных файлов. Старые логи могут конфликтовать с новой версией службы, либо само обновление содержит ошибку в коде менеджера логирования, вызывающую циклическую запись.

Может ли SilentLog быть вирусом?

Сам по себе процесс SilentLogManagerService — это легитимный компонент Samsung. Однако, если вы видите процесс с похожим названием, но расположенный не в системной папке, или он требует странных разрешений, стоит проверить телефон антивирусом.

Вернется ли SilentLog после сброса настроек?

Да, при сбросе до заводских настроек (Factory Reset) все системные службы, включая SilentLog, возвращаются к состоянию по умолчанию. Если проблема была в программном сбое, сброс может её решить, и процесс будет работать нормально.

Нужны ли Root права для отключения SilentLog?

Нет, root-права не обязательны. Достаточно использовать меню *#9900# или команды ADB с компьютера, чтобы остановить или отключить этот процесс для текущего пользователя.